顯示具有 EeePC 標籤的文章。 顯示所有文章
顯示具有 EeePC 標籤的文章。 顯示所有文章

2007年12月6日 星期四

台師大國文學系教育實習課:動態組字淺介

最信實、簡約的資訊內容傳遞方式,莫過於文章書信,到了數位時代,其重要性更是不減反增。又構成文章的基礎是文字,而一個文字系統是否有足夠的彈性,會大幅影響其文章書信的表意效率、描述範圍的深廣度。但在數位時代,漢字的相關數位標準過去幾乎都是「工業用字」(你猜的沒錯,最一開始的目的只是工業用途:紙盒包裝印刷等等)標準,由所謂權威人士選擇大部份人的常用字一字編一碼,成為有限字集,這種作法也許能更應付一開始的需求,但限制住今天電腦上漢文的表達能力(今日的電腦跟30年前的電腦用途不同了)與彈性,缺字重重,永遠解決不完。

所以誕生了動態組字的技術體系,該體系是對常用漢字與部件做編碼,以組合符與各級部件的組合描述式,更有效率的來呈現、交換漢字的字形,能普及的話,這會大大改善一般電腦上的漢文表述能力,再也沒有缺字問題。然而在現階段,最苦惱缺字問題的使用者,其實還是文、史、教工作者,如果連這群power users們,因為害羞而不敢大聲說出需求的話,需求不強烈,我等的技術者有什麼理由或是動機來做動態組字呢?

年初在可攜式造字引擎專利釋放發表會上認識的台師大國文學系亓亭亭老師是位非常熱心的長者,亓老師一直很關心動態組字的發展,有一次我跟她聊到了這個狀況,亓老師提議把這個概念分享給正在實習中的「未來老師」們,我想這是個很方法,於是今日上午就應約在他們的課程中做個分享,題目是動態組字淺介。

早上從桃園作火車上去時,發生了小插曲,這次是我第一次帶EeePC出門開講,然而前一天,我複製了一些PC上常用的字型到EeePC上,車上開機,做事前預演,沒想到慘劇發生XD,華碩的系統設計有錯誤,自己加字型進去到/usr/share/fonts/freetype/arphic(從大筆電的的同一位置複製過來)內會導致開不完機(一直重新啟動xwindow),而開機選單也沒有console來修復,臨時只好趕快用系統回復XD,然後憑記憶把設定休回來。

準時到了師大(嘿嘿carryme真是吾人好伙伴),現在的大學(或是是台師大等國立大學)真進步,普通教室就有投影機了!不過這裡又發生一點點小慘劇,其投影機制是新採購的「黑盒子」電腦系統,其特製的操作面板非常複雜XD,跟投影機的連線狀況時好時壞!(會自動關機),一開始花了十多分鐘處理這個,實在辛苦了該課程的某位女同學與某資訊中心人員XD,本來預計講30分鐘的內容,時間控制有驚無險XD,講完後還剩下10分鐘。好在安排的一些趣味點還算有效地提起大家的興趣,以及分享了動態組字這技術體系的概念,而且最重要的,我說明了一點:希望大家不要只滿足於當一個軟體消費者,一般學文的人比較害羞,然而需求說不出來,就不會有人來幫文人做好用的軟體!

過去有不少文人會怪做電腦的亂作,沒有請他們來指導做出好的輸入法、字庫、字形等等,事實上電腦科技的世界很現實,翹二郎腿來等人邀請去指導的思維,除非很有利益可圖、很有市場價值,不然是不會有人甩專家的,你罵你的,微軟照樣一意孤行,你能耐何?也只能吞聲下氣買單罷了。我想,坐等著消費,對軟體功能抱怨連連,不如起而找機會幫忙改善軟體。雖然過去文字學家在數位科技裏面的編碼議題缺席了,然而動態組字這技術體系正在成長的階段,這就是一個新的機會。與其被動的在家裡期待某個好人會做出好軟體(公主期待白馬王子??XD),不如主動出擊,更何況,個人做動態組字相關的東西,是以開放原碼社群的方式經營,這種模式非常的庶民、草根,即便只是大學部學生,有心也能一起來改良軟體,眾志成城,也是莫大的貢獻,我想這是今日本人最主要表達的想法。

留給台師大本日聽這堂課的學員們:今天給你們看的只是一個展示程式(目前真正有用的功能是:做印章、印貼紙、衣服XD),其背後是一個技術體系,可以做很多事情。將來可能會有有完整組字功能的編輯器、再難的字也能輕易查出來的輸入法、方便國字教學的軟體等等,可能性非常多,各位聽完我今天的簡介後,請回去沈澱、思考,怎麼樣的未來軟體可以幫助到你們?把需求整理提出來,連絡上我本人或是相關的社群,將來互相討論、協做,就會誕生更好用的工具,讓各位能做更好的教學

ps.簡報檔我整理過後,近日會放上網

2007年11月15日 星期四

超長距離的fon熱區




這次修正標題應該是超長而不是超廣,重新佈好線(買了材料敲敲叮叮~_~),把fon放在窗簾架的上,天線拉出去,貼在牆壁(把手臂奮力深出去儘量貼高),本來整棟樓都有訊號了,現在更是把訊號可以投比較遠。然後屋外牆上貼紹fon貼紙就大功告成了(間接承認過去比較自私/_\)。





架好了後,今天拿著我的EeePC上街實際測量連熱點public頻道投射狀況(鄉民們看到拿著筆電的筆者在街上邊走邊看電腦螢幕可能以為是在調查什麼吧?XD),得出這張圖。綠色的線,是打開Ezpeer+網路音樂播放,邊走邊播放「悲傷的茱麗葉」(我從國小六年級開始就很喜歡伊能靜)不會間斷的範圍,大致上一整個區塊巷子的兩邊訊號都不錯,100~90%

黃線是音樂會間斷,但仍可以看網頁的範圍,最後紅線是有訊號但小於50%。

由於個人住老舊社區,房子大部份比較矮小,我找了一個比較高的地方裝上fon的指向天線,橫跨的距離長的蠻驚訝的,以紅線來說往上跨出圖片後,還會過兩個十字路口才沒有訊號,實際壓馬路去到處測試,發現不光是fon好,EeePC的無線晶片也很不錯,可以收到那麼遠的訊號,EeePC跟Fon真是好朋友。

只有fon,分享的範圍只有在一棟房子周圍一點點的範圍內,加上Fon的指向型天線分享的距離變得好大!真是好物。

超廣距離的fon熱區(跨3個十字路口喔)

買了fon跟天線很久,卻沒有好好利用。買了EeePC以後,終於發現fon的價值,fon簡直是EeePC最好的朋友!今天做了大工程。
好累明天再補完。

2007年11月9日 星期五

易PC有虛擬桌面嗎?

11/13更正錯字:7.20應為7.10
答案是有的!

用終端機進入icewm的目錄:
cd /etc/X11/icewm

less keys,可以發現ctrl+alt加上數字鍵可以切換虛擬桌面。其實synaptic、aptitude等套件管理程式也早就預裝好了,只是華碩沒把他們放進桌面選單中,我想華碩是來不及寫好自己加程式到選單的軟體吧?所以乾脆先藏起來。

回到虛擬桌面的問題,大家應該很喜歡桌面Linux的compiz吧?有了EeePC,知道顯示晶片是不差的i910系列,所以應該可以作跟桌面Linux一樣的3d桌面吧?可惜我試過裝debian etch的compiz,結果缺了clearlook的theme元件,無法啟動,很可惜(有待研究,不過為了用compiz,改裝Ubuntu7.10會比較快...只是自己得調校許多東西),不過有另一一種方法可以過過乾癮:裝3ddesk這個偽3d虛擬桌面切換器,然後再增加熱鍵:sudo nano /etc/X11/icewm/keys(使用前先備份該檔:sudo cp /etc/X11/icewm/keys /etc/X11/icewm/keys .bck)
增加:
key "Alt+Ctrl+s" 3ddesk --zoomspeed 10 --changespeed 5
key "Alt+Ctrl+z" 3ddesk --zoomspeed 10 --changespeed 5 --gotoleft
key "Alt+Ctrl+x" 3ddesk --zoomspeed 10 --changespeed 5 --gotoright

這樣就有簡單的3d虛擬桌面切換功能了。

2007年11月8日 星期四

我看Eeepc(易PC)


昨晚花了些時間研究了一下Eeepc。這裡再次的感謝剎那搜尋工坊的CEO陳昌江先生基於進行數位漢字基礎工程的理由,給我的贊助。

首先先看工業設計:




電源開關設計成閡起來也可以按,不知這有何作用?









鍵盤上的導引鍵(請看J)只是一個小小的點,摸起來有跟沒有差不多,忙打會有小障礙,這設計不好,應該做大一點。








  • 「電源適配器」(在台灣賣易PC,用詞也不改一下,不太尊重本國消費者)是個很失敗的設計,這種直式大大的電源供應器,有個非常大的問題,如照片所現,至少會卡到3個插座!這個插頭外型很明顯的學了OLPC外表,然而沒有抄到人家設計的內涵:電源供應器大規大,但是橫的,一條電腦延長線可以交錯的插很多OLPC,5插座就是插五台,然而易PC恐怕只能插2台,這麼基本的設計點都做不好,令人懷疑ASUS的工業設計團隊的能力?




開機來看看吧,有人說不喜歡這個像翻譯機的介面,我倒不這麼認為,螢幕解析度又這麼小,又Eeepc的設計點是易學易上手,這樣的介面清楚一目瞭然,是再好也不過的。只不過華碩這套ICEWM的改良介面,沒有做出自己加程式的功能,是很大的缺憾。此外預設的程式裏面選用的不適當,例如PlanetRacer(企鵝滑雪)那個程式是需要比較好的CPU,但卻放到易PC上,據說是基於散熱與使用時間的因素所以CPU降頻到600多MHz,使得PlanetRacer跑起來FPS只有個位數,選這個遊戲可玩性變很低,有點是砸自己的招牌,很不適當,還不如選:tuxkart、tuxpunk、pingus、super-tux其他Tux(一隻企鵝,Linux吉祥物)系列的遊戲,可愛好玩又可以在易PC上運作順暢。

不過就選單所見,易PC很web2.0,跟維基百科、google docs、gmail等網路服務接軌、還有中英字典,感覺起來很適合做維基人寫作專用的第1台電腦,不過這方面應該可以做更完整,加上flickr、facebook等聯結捷徑更完整(其實在firefox自己家就好了書籤)。不過Eeepc不透明化給人裝程式的機制,我覺得有失EeePC之所以易的精神。








其實自己加程式也沒什麼難的,易PC的作業系統,用的是Xandros Linux,Xandros是一套衍生自Debian的發行套件,所以其軟體套件管理系統就是用debian廣為人知的deb格式套件與apt機制,簡單說,就是只要能上網,就可以連到指定的網路套件庫,下載新的軟體,而這些套件庫可以說是上天下海、無所不包,就像過去大部份人使用windows的回憶幾十片的補帖。然而用補帖畢竟不安全,非法的東西因為來路不明,中毒、被裝後門,只能願打願哀。但Debian的套件庫都是合法的開源軟體,整理嚴謹,用的心安、安全,功能一樣很多,但沒有病毒、劊客的糾纏,何樂而不為呢?


拉雜了太多,說到正題,怎麼增加套件庫呢?目前最簡單的作法是:下載LazyEeepc,他就會幫你加上Debian的套件列表(幾乎EeePC都可以吃)

我裝了一些東西:
















誰說Linux沒有好遊戲呢?其實還,有一堆Xmame之類的大型電玩模擬器呢,這幾個軟體依序是pcmanx(上bbs,真方便蹲廁所也可以用XD)、powermanga(射擊遊戲有衛星、不同武器的設定喔)、egoboo(可愛型的Diablo-like遊戲,在易PC上超順的說,不選這個卻選planetplayer真怪...)、tuxpuck(桌上曲棍球)、qgo網路圍棋軟體(以可以跟Gnugo這個超強人工智慧圍棋軟體較勁,對我這個十多級的肉腳,gnugo很機車也很有挑戰性)、supertux(碼利兄弟-like)、pingus(旅鼠總動員-like,這個很好玩!)





此外,模擬器方面,我裝了dosbox,給大家看看,來瞧瞧抓圖吧:

















其實這是回應mobile上面有些人的疑問。








此外還有小問題,Eeepc內裝有java5的JRE,但中文有亂碼問題!


總的來看,我覺得易PC老實說沒有技術上的創新,但有商業概念上的革新!這台很值得買給家中老爹、老母、或是維基百科的入門者,雖然華碩看來還在摸索這新的生意模式,但我想,使用apt軟體取而不盡又安全的網路套件庫這是目前用Debian系的Linux最殺手的應用,華碩要不增加軟體維護的部門,自己維護一套套件庫,不然就應該透明化自己加軟體的機制,委外給像Ubuntu、/Debian等一類有在維護套件的組織,順便贊助Debian達到雙贏。

count